该怎么样判断check box是选中还是未选中?

解决方案 »

  1.   

    UpdateData(true)
    m_Check -->Assosiate with CheckBox
    if(1==m_Check.Value) //select
    {}
    else
    {}
      

  2.   

    定义一个变量CButton m_Radio_Test
    if (m_Radio_Test.Get())  //如果被选中
    {
       MessageBox("选我干什么?无聊!","提示",MB_OK|MB_ICONINFORMATION);
    }
    else
    {
       MessageBox("为什么不选我?没道理!","提示",MB_OK|MB_ICONINFORMATION);
    }
      

  3.   

    不好意思,刚才语误,现修改如下:
    定义一个变量CButton m_Radio_Test
    if (m_Radio_Test.Get())  //如果被选中
    {
       MessageBox("选我干什么?无聊!","提示",MB_OK|MB_ICONINFORMATION);
    }
    else
    {
       MessageBox("为什么不选我?没道理!","提示",MB_OK|MB_ICONINFORMATION);}
      

  4.   

    不好意思,刚才语误,现修改如下:if (m_Radio_Test.GetCheck())  //如果被选中
      

  5.   

    CButton *m_Radio;
    m_Radio=(CButton *)GetDlgItem(IDC....);
    m_Radio->GetCheck()